Description

Kennel Farm Cottage is a house dating from the late 16th century, with possible remains of a larger house. It features a timber frame on a brick and render plinth, with brick infill and a plain tiled roof that is hipped at the right end. The building has two storeys and three framed bays. There is a tall rebuilt stack located at the center. On both floors, there are two three-light metal casement windows. The central entrance consists of a half-glazed door that is sheltered by a flat hood. Additionally, there is a pentice extension at the right end.
